Day One: Golden Hour and D-Log Color

Camera Settings That Worked

I set the Mini 5 Pro to shoot 4K/60fps in D-Log for maximum dynamic range. Coastal vineyards present a brutal exposure challenge: bright ocean sky above, dark shadowed vine canopy below. D-Log captured 12.6 stops of dynamic range, preserving detail in both the whitecapped Pacific and the shaded grape clusters.

Key settings I locked in:

  • ISO 100 (native) to minimize noise
  • Shutter speed 1/120s (double the frame rate rule)
  • ND16 filter to control coastal glare
  • Manual white balance at 5600K for consistency across clips
  • Color profile: D-Log for flat, gradeable footage

Pro Tip: When filming vineyards in D-Log, expose 0.7 stops to the right of your histogram center. Vine leaves reflect unpredictable amounts of green-channel light, and slight overexposure protects shadow detail in the soil between rows without clipping foliage highlights.

Day Two: When the Weather Turned

Fog, Wind, and Obstacle Avoidance Under Pressure

This is the section every coastal drone pilot needs to read. At 10:47 AM, I was mid-flight executing a Hyperlapse orbit around the estate barn when a fog bank rolled off the Pacific at startling speed. Visibility dropped from 5 miles to roughly 800 meters in under four minutes.

Three things happened simultaneously:

  • Wind gusted from 12 to 23 mph as the marine layer pushed inland
  • Ambient light dropped by 2.3 stops, forcing an automatic ISO bump
  • Moisture began condensing on the forward-facing obstacle avoidance sensors

The Mini 5 Pro's omnidirectional obstacle avoidance system immediately flagged a eucalyptus tree line 15 meters to the drone's left that had become invisible to me from my ground position. The drone auto-braked, hovered, and displayed a hazard warning on my DJI RC 2 controller. I triggered Return to Home, and the aircraft navigated back using its downward vision system and GPS, landing within 12 centimeters of its takeoff point.

Without obstacle avoidance, that eucalyptus grove would have claimed the drone—and my client's footage.

Expert Insight: Coastal fog doesn't just reduce visibility. It deposits a micro-film of saltwater on optical sensors. After every foggy flight, I wipe all six obstacle avoidance sensor windows with a microfiber cloth dampened with distilled water. Salt residue degrades sensor accuracy over time and can cause phantom braking in clear conditions.

Post-Production: Grading Coastal D-Log Footage

D-Log footage from the Mini 5 Pro responds exceptionally well to DaVinci Resolve's color wheels. My grading workflow for the vineyard reel:

  • Lift shadows by 15% to reveal soil texture between rows
  • Pull green saturation down by 10% to avoid the "radioactive vine" look
  • Add a subtle teal-to-orange contrast curve for that coastal warmth
  • Sharpen at 40% radius to recover D-Log's intentional softness
  • Apply a light film grain at 0.3 intensity for organic texture

The final export maintained the 10-bit color depth captured in-camera, which meant no banding in the gradient sky transitions—a problem that plagues 8-bit drone footage constantly.

Common Mistakes to Avoid

Flying too high over vineyards. Most pilots default to 100+ meters for dramatic wide shots. Vineyard footage gains intimacy at 8-15 meters AGL, where you can see individual grape clusters and the texture of hand-tended soil. Reserve high-altitude passes for mapping only.

Ignoring wind direction relative to vine rows. Flying perpendicular to rows in gusty conditions creates micro-turbulence as wind eddies between the vine walls. Fly parallel to rows whenever wind exceeds 15 mph for smoother footage and less gimbal strain.

Skipping ND filters in coastal light. The combination of ocean reflection and open sky creates harsh, blown-out footage even on overcast days. Carry ND8, ND16, and ND32 filters as a minimum coastal kit.

Using ActiveTrack without a pre-planned flight path. Subject tracking works brilliantly, but the drone doesn't know about property boundaries, power lines, or trellis wires. Walk the tracking path on foot first and identify every potential obstacle above 2 meters height.

Recording in Normal color profile to "save time." The 20 extra minutes spent grading D-Log footage yields dramatically better results than any Normal-profile clip. Clients see the difference immediately, and it directly impacts whether they hire you again.

Frequently Asked Questions

Can the Mini 5 Pro handle salt air during extended coastal shoots?

The Mini 5 Pro is not IP-rated for salt spray, so it has no formal saltwater resistance. During my three-day coastal shoot, I stored it in a sealed Pelican case with silica gel packets between flights. I also wiped down the airframe and gimbal with a barely damp microfiber cloth after each session. After 14 total flights in coastal conditions, the drone showed zero corrosion or performance degradation. The key is prevention—never leave the drone exposed to salt air while powered off and idle.

Is D-Log worth the extra post-production effort for vineyard content?

Absolutely. Vineyard footage lives or dies on color accuracy. Clients want reds that look like Pinot Noir, greens that feel alive, and skies that evoke the terroir. D-Log gives you 12+ stops of dynamic range and a flat profile that accepts color grading without introducing artifacts. Shooting in Normal locks you into the camera's interpretation of the scene, which almost always oversaturates vine greens and clips coastal sky highlights.

How does the Mini 5 Pro's obstacle avoidance compare to larger drones in tight vineyard environments?

The omnidirectional system detects obstacles in all directions simultaneously, including below—which matters when descending between vine rows. In my testing, the system reliably detected trellis wires as thin as 4mm at distances of 8 meters in good lighting. In fog or low light, detection range drops to approximately 5 meters, so reduce your flight speed to under 2 m/s in those conditions. Compared to the Air 3, the detection algorithms feel equally responsive despite the Mini 5 Pro's significant size and weight advantage.
